Procedure steps

WARNING: This page does not describe the selected car, but rather 6 other vehicles, including the 2016 BMW 328i xDrive, 2016 BMW 328d xDrive, 2015 BMW 328i xDrive, 2015 BMW 328d xDrive, and 2014 BMW 328i xDrive.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

General information safety instructions 

RISK OF DAMAGE

Scratches. 

Tools and sharp-edged components can cause scratches.

Preprocesses 

  1. Remove decorative trim on center console 
    • For equipment specification with in leather instrument panel: Attach plastic adhesive tape (2) between decorative trim (1) and instrument panel.

    • Detach decorative trim (1) with special tool 0 496 571 (00 9 327)  from clamps (2).
    • If necessary, unlock associated plug connections and disconnect.
    • Remove decorative trim (1) upwards.

  2. Remove trim for selector lever 
    • Partially fit special tool 0 493 687 (00 9 340)  as pictured.
    • Lift trim for selector lever (1) all around and remove upwards.
    • If necessary, unlock associated plug connection and disconnect.

  3. Removing the operating unit for the center console 
    • Adhere to following procedure:
      1. Reach under front section of operating unit for the center console (1).
      2. Press front latch mechanism in direction of arrow and simultaneously raise operating unit for the center console (1) towards top.
      3. Disconnect associated plug connection and remove operating unit for the center console (1).

    Keyprocesses 

  4. Removing the trim for the center console 
    • Loosen screws (1).
    • Detach trim for center console (2) with special tool 0 496 569 (00 9 325)  for clamps (3).
    • Slightly raise trim for center console (2) and disconnect associated plug connections.
    • Guide out trim for center console (2) to the top/rear.

  5. Installing the trim for the center console 
    • Do not detach springs (1) during installation.
    • Replace faulty clamps.

    • Connect all plug connections.
    • Position trim for center console (2).
    • Clip in trim for center console (2) at latch mechanisms (3).
    • Tighten the screws (1).
